Title: | A Library of Late Type Spectral Templates in the CO 2.3-2.4mu region at R=5900 |
PI: | Claudia Winge |
Co-I(s): | Thaisa Storchi-Bergmann, Rogemar Riffel |
Abstract
We propose to observe with the GNIRS IFU a good
sized sample of spectral template stars at moderate S/N (~50-60), at
R=5900 resolution for the region including the CO 2.3-2.4mu
overtone bands, to be used as a library for analysis of the stellar kinematic in nearby galaxies both
active nuclei and quiescent. At low to moderate S/N, the cross correlation technique
is very sensitive to the spectral type of the template star. A late
spectral template combined with a low S/N will result in
over-estimating the velocity dispersion. Using a combination of
templates or testing different spectral types is the best approach,
but opposite to what is seen in the optical where a large number of
libraries spanning a range of spectral types exists, in the near-IR at
R=6000 there are very little if any datasets available.
